Transaction 7df6b67db21034c9138a60b52729dc625dc1fd910db8873176ddaf42520b4b89
2 Input
2 Outputs
- 7df6b67db21034c9138a60b52729dc625dc1fd910db8873176ddaf42520b4b89:0
- 7df6b67db21034c9138a60b52729dc625dc1fd910db8873176ddaf42520b4b89:1
value 636532
address 1DaVWBiLGzbpqZrSdWSs59cM4NoZAzX8b9
value 1591618
address 17ZY2c8HcZefDMCqxXqLZ6yefLcWFCpmoY